From Dated to Dream Home: 6 Kitchen Renovations That Sold Faster

A kitchen renovation isn’t just about aesthetics—it’s one of the smartest investments you can make in your home. According to the National Association of Realtors, an updated kitchen can recover 60-80% of its cost at resale and help your home sell 30% faster than outdated properties.
